Save monitor configurations of Windows 7 or 10 and easily switch between them with a click in a popup menu of your taskbar.
The tool is designed for users with two or more monitors who in certain situations would like to quickly change their monitor setup (e.g. enable/disable a TV which is attached to the HDMI port, make an attached TV the primary display to remove tearing switch which monitor is on the left/right...). Along the monitor state and setup the resolution is also saved and restored.
The program works by saving a current monitor setup as configured using the windows control panel to an xml file. Once saved the configuration can be quickly restored at any time. Requires .NET 4.0 Framework to be installed.
The program is quite simple and in an early development stage. It is provided without any warranty. If you accidentally disable all your monitors boot into safe mode to fix the problem.

It's very good BUT (hence 4 stars) - does not support switching between individual monitors setups and nvidia surround, so when that one is enabled (unfortunately some games require it!), i cannot use monswicher to switch to other setups. Otherwise, aside from lacking that feature - brilliant!

Love it! Very handy for when I use Parsec on a remote machine with only one monitor, while the host has two. It seems to also remember the refresh rate of the different presets (144hz for dual, 60hz for single over Parsec), but that might be a Windows behavior. The app would be absolutely perfect for me if it had the option to include desktop scaling values in the preset!
